About Kipyegon Kitur
Kipyegon Kitur is a scholar working on Immunology, Infectious Diseases and Microbiology, having authored 7 papers that have together received 500 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Immune Response and Inflammation (3 papers), Cell death mechanisms and regulation (2 papers) and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ology (219 citations), Microbiology (44 citations) and Infectious Diseases (123 citations). Kipyegon Kitur has collaborated with scholars based in United States and Chile. Frequent co-authors include Alice Prince, Dane Parker, Sarah Wachtel, Susan M. Bueno, Danielle Ahn, Taylor S. Cohen, Pamela A. Nieto, Samuel Chung, Armand Brown and Grace Soong. Their work appears in journals such as Immunity, Gastroenterology and The FASEB Journal.
